<h3>What is a healthful food choice?</h3>

A healthful food choice is a balanced and nutritional food diet that consists of all classes of food. A healthy food choice contains:

  • Fruits and vegetables
  • Whole grains
  • Low-fat milk products, and
  • Calcium-rich foods.

A healthy food choice is devoid of saturated fats. It is recommended to eat a healthful food choice in order to maintain good nutritional health conditions.

What effect will the calcitonin injections have on the calcitonin-treated rat’s vertebral bone density?
irakobra [83]

Answer:

The answer is - The calcitonin injections will increase the rat's vertebral bone density (indicated by a less-negative T score)

Explanation:

Calcitonin is produced in the thyroid gland by the parafollicular cells. It is a hormone which prevents the development of osteoporosis by reducing bone resorption and is known to increase bone density. Administering calcitonin to the rats resulted in their T score becoming less negative compared to the control rat therefore showing that it reduced the progression of osteoporosis.
